Here are some ways to learn English: 1. [Memory Connection Method: Connecting the unfamiliar with the familiar is the general rule of memory.] 2. ** Imitation Method **: Imitation is the fundamental method of learning English. 3. ** Learning Method **: If it's for the exam, focus on memorizing words. If it's for speaking, focus on memorizing sentences. 4. ** Word Recitation Enhancement Method **: Use about two months to memorize words crazily. Every day, memorize about 100 words. The next morning, repeat the words that you memorized the day before. If you persist, you can quickly increase your vocabulary. 5. ** Audition Learning Method **: Watch and listen to Travelling America for two months. At the same time, you can listen to English songs, English animations, and movies to expand your knowledge. 6. ** Learning method of phonology **: Learn to master the pronunciation of 48 phonology symbols, and remember special words with special pronunciation changes. After learning the pronunciation, one could spell many words by themselves. The natural pronunciation in many children's English textbooks was actually the development of the pronunciation. 7. ** Listening, Speaking, Reading and Writing Sequence Method **: Listen to the standard pronunciation first, then imitate it yourself, then read (see) the words and sentences, and finally write them down to strengthen the order of learning English. 8. Step by Step Method: Learn from easy to difficult, from little to much. Learn simple words and sentences first, then slowly increase the difficulty and quantity. 9. ** Open mouth practice method **: You have to open your mouth to read and speak English. 10. [Life Usage Method: Try to say the English words of the objects you see in your life. If you don't know them, you can look them up in the dictionary.] 11. ** Practice Method of Condensing Reading **: Use Condensing Reading more often. 12. ** Speaking and repeating method **: Watch a Short videos, press pause and repeat what you hear. 13. ** Foreign Language Thinking Cultivation Method **: Cultivate the habit of "explaining a foreign language in a foreign language" instead of immediately translating new words into your mother tongue. When speaking and writing English, don't think about Chinese before translating. 14. [Clear goal method: Before learning English, ask yourself why you want to learn English and what level you want to reach. Understanding these questions will help you start learning better.] 15. ** Pronunciation Learning Method **: Start learning authentic American pronunciation from the vocals and the concondants. At the same time, learn common words and oral expressions in life. Read more exciting novels for free

The Way of Learning from a Teacher

"Master" had many meanings. Generally speaking, it was a system of imitating someone or a certain school and inheriting their traditions. It was a system passed down from master to disciple. It had different manifestations in different fields: - In the field of detective novels, authors like Shi Chengyan, although they didn't mention the relationship between teachers and students, might be influenced by their predecessors in the process of writing and constantly accumulate their own writing style and achievements. - In the field of Chinese medicine, Chinese medicine mentorship was a way for part-time Chinese medicine professionals to legally obtain a medical license through learning from a teacher. There was the "3-year apprenticeship" policy in 2007 (required to be with a teacher for at least 3 years, applicable to Chinese medicine enthusiasts or practitioners with high school or high school equivalent education, required to be "apprenticed" to establish a master-disciple relationship and a series of processes) and the "5-year apprenticeship" policy in 2017 (required to be with a teacher for at least 5 years, no academic qualifications, no need to find a teacher to verify the master-disciple relationship, but required to sign a apprenticeship contract, platform filing, etc.). - In the field of education, apprenticeship education was a way of education. For example, in the Chinese medicine talent training system planned by the Ministry of Education and the State Administration of Traditional Chinese Medicine by 2020, apprenticeship education ran through three stages: college education, post-graduation education, and continuing education. - In other industries, such as the marketing field, there was also a teacher-disciple relationship. Through apprenticeship, skills, morality, and culture were passed down. The apprentice learned from the master modestly, and the master taught him everything. The Importance of Learning English through English Stories

English stories are great for learning English as they expose you to natural language use. You can learn new words, phrases and grammar in context. For example, in a story about a journey, you might learn travel - related vocabulary.

Are there any free English stories for learning English?

Yes, there are many. You can find them on websites like Project Gutenberg. It offers a vast collection of classic English literature for free. You can choose stories according to your level and interests. For beginners, simple fairy tales or short stories are great. They help in improving vocabulary and basic grammar.

Is learning English by story effective?

Definitely. Learning English by story is very effective. It makes the learning process more interesting compared to just memorizing grammar rules. In a story, you can see how real people use the language in different situations. Also, stories often have dialogues which are great for learning natural speech patterns.
